Firstly, what does financial propriety mean? To put it simply, financial propriety typically suggests managing public money and business finances in such a way which is compliant to the legislation. Simply put, it implies that business owners need to make certain that the way their company handles their finances is constantly in accordance with legal regulations and criteria. For instance, one of the primary ways to ensure this is to always keep your accounting books up-dated. Whilst huge companies usually tend to have a whole team of financial experts and accountants, if you are a local business owner this responsibility falls into your hands. This means that one of your essential duties is to incorporate a dependable accountancy system right into your company. It additionally suggests routinely and thoroughly documenting all of the business' monetary transactions, featuring expenses such as inventory and payroll accounts. Making sure that you keep an exact, updated and detailed document of all your business finances is an essential component of being a prosperous business owner.

As an example, one of the most legit financial strategies of a company is to always keep separate accounts for business and personal funds. Among the most significant missteps that brand-new business owners make is tangling up their personal funds with the company's finances. Doing this is not only a recipe for confusion, yet it can also bring about possible legal ramifications. It is absolutely not worth the risk, which is why a vital stage of starting up a brand-new company is to activate a different bank account for your firm. Having a separate business checking account makes it a lot easier to keep a record of costs and profit, along with offering an additional layer of protection for your own personal assets too.
